1A) As below Display one the PLC controlled Decanter Centrifuge touch screen, we can see 1 start & 1 stop button for centrifuge, 1 start and stop button for pump.

PLC Decanter Centrifuge Auto Model Operation.
1B) The VFD+PLC Centrifuge have two Mode, one is Auto Mode, if we choose Auto Model, first we set the Centrifuge Bowl speed, and Differential Speed, then press Decanter Centrifuge Start Button , The PLC will control to start the back motor first, and main motor, later we press the pump start Button, the pump will run until to the max capacity the centrifuge can handle.
1C) As set in the PLC, we can only start the Decanter Centrifuge start button to run the back drive motor first, second the main motor, finally the pump motor. If we do not follow the order of the starting, to protect the centrifuge, the pump motor will not start even we press the pump start first.
1D) Once the centrifuge is in overload, the PLC will stop the pump, and later stop the main motor, finally, stop the back drive motor.( This is present program in the PLC)
But for 1D) we can updated the PLC decanter centrifuge to following.
1D Updated) Once is in overload, the PLC will slow down the pump to lower down the pump capacity to the centrifuge max capacity, if the centrifuge is still in overload, the PLC will stop the pump, and later stop the main motor and finally the back drive motor.
1E) When we stop the centrifuge, the stop order is: first the pump, later the main motor, finally the back drive motor, if we do not follow the order, the PLC will control not to stop the centrifuge.

Manual Mode Operation of the PLC Decanter Centrifuge
2A) If we run the centrifuge in Manual model, first we set the bowl speed, and set differential speed, and set the pump capacity. When we start, we can only follow the order to press the bowl start and the pump start, if not, no motor will start.
2B) In the manual mode, if we stop the centrifuge, it is the same like 1E). the stop order is: first the pump, later the main motor, finally the back drive motor, if we do not follow the order, the PLC will control not to stop the centrifuge.
2C) In the manual mode, if the centrifuge is in overload, the PLC will stop the pump, and later stop the main motor, finally, stop the back drive motor.( This is present program in the PLC)
But for 2C) we can updated to following.
2C Updated) Once is in overload, the PLC will slow down the pump to lower down the pump capacity to the centrifuge max capacity ,if the centrifuge is still in overload, the PLC will stop the pump, and later stop the main motor and finally the back drive motor.
Moreover, For option, we can choose to install the temperature sensor for the bearings, and vibration sensor for the PLC Decanter Centrifuge. If the bearing increasing temperature is higher than 50C° the centrifuge will stop automatically. And if the vibration is higher than the standard, the PLC Decanter centrifuge will stop automatically. But this will be higher cost.
